Ingredients
Scale
2 tablespoons olive oil
1 medium onion, diced
3 cloves garlic, minced
2 medium carrots, diced
2 celery stalks, diced
2 cups cooked chicken, shredded
4 cups chicken broth
1 cup heavy cream
1 teaspoon Italian seasoning
1/4 teaspoon nutmeg
Salt and pepper, to taste
1 package (16 oz) potato gnocchi
2 cups fresh spinach, chopped
Instructions
Heat olive oil in a large pot over medium heat. Sauté onion, garlic, carrots, and celery until softened (5-7 minutes).
Add chicken broth, heavy cream, Italian seasoning, nutmeg, salt, and pepper. Bring to a simmer.
Stir in shredded chicken and gnocchi. Cook for 5-7 minutes or until gnocchi is tender.
Add spinach and cook for 2 minutes until wilted. Adjust seasoning as needed.
Serve hot with crusty bread or crackers.
Notes
Use rotisserie chicken for a quicker option.
Swap heavy cream for half-and-half for a lighter version.
